GCKMultizoneDevice 클래스

GCKMultizoneDevice 클래스 참조

개요

멀티 영역 그룹의 구성원 기기입니다.

이후
3.1

NSObject, <NSCopying>, <NSSecureCoding>을 상속합니다.

인스턴스 메서드 요약

(instancetype) - initWithJSONObject:
 주어진 JSON 데이터로 객체를 초기화합니다. 더보기
 
(instancetype) - initWithDeviceID:friendlyName:capabilities:volumeLevel:muted:
 지정된 이니셜라이저입니다. 더보기
 

숙박 시설 요약

NSString * deviceID
 고유 기기 ID입니다. 더보기
 
NSString * friendlyName
 기기의 별칭입니다. 더보기
 
NSInteger capabilities
 기기 기능입니다. 더보기
 
float volumeLevel
 기기 볼륨 수준입니다. 더보기
 
BOOL muted
 기기가 음소거되었는지 여부입니다. 더보기
 

메소드 세부정보

- (instancetype) initWithJSONObject: (id)  JSONObject

주어진 JSON 데이터로 객체를 초기화합니다.

- (instancetype) initWithDeviceID: (NSString *)  deviceID
friendlyName: (NSString *)  friendlyName
capabilities: (NSInteger)  capabilities
volumeLevel: (float)  volume
muted: (BOOL)  muted 

지정된 이니셜라이저입니다.

Parameters
deviceIDThe unique device ID.
friendlyNameThe device's friendly name.
capabilitiesThe device capabilities.
volumeThe device volume level.
mutedWhether the device is muted.

숙박 시설 세부정보

- (NSString*) deviceID
readnonatomiccopy

고유 기기 ID입니다.

- (NSString*) friendlyName
readnonatomiccopy

기기의 별칭입니다.

- (NSInteger) capabilities
readwritenonatomicassign

기기 기능입니다.

- (float) volumeLevel
readwritenonatomicassign

기기 볼륨 수준입니다.

- (BOOL) muted
readwritenonatomicassign

기기가 음소거되었는지 여부입니다.